Magnetic Resonance Urography (MRU)

  • Magnetic Resonance Urography offers excellent anatomical visualisation and multiplanar 3D reconstruction as well as an assessment of differential renal function and drainage. 16,17 It provides detailed information on renal pathology within a single study which correlates well with surgical findings. 18,19
  • MRU can accurately demonstrate all the common causes of antenatally detected hydronephrosis and guide subsequent management. 18,20
  • Gadolinium-DTPA dimeglumine is used to assess the excretion and drainage of the kidneys.
  • Advantages include:

    ●  Assessment of anatomical structure and function in a single study

    ●  Advoids ionising radiation

  • Disadvantages include:

    ●  May require sedation and anaesthesia in young children

    ●  Relatively expensive with limited availability and requiring local expertise
